WAGNER expands in Vietnam and Southeast Asia

 Tuesday, September 9, 2025

WAGNER_Vietnam & Southeast Asia

Since 2022, J. Wagner Asia Pte. Ltd. in Ho Chi Minh City has been driving WAGNER’s expansion in one of the world’s most dynamic economic regions. Southeast Asia is rapidly evolving into a hub for innovation and technology – offering enormous potential for globally active companies.

With around 140 employees across technology, production, marketing, sales, and service, WAGNER’s Vietnam site is already a powerhouse. The 10,000 m² facility includes modern offices, a large warehouse, and a demonstration line for liquid and powder coating systems. It supports both their Industrial Solutions and Decorative Finishing divisions – and they’re just getting started: full system projects for the Asian market will be realised here in the future.

WAGNER offers innovative coating solutions for Wood & MDF

One wood is not just like another – they vary widely. On the one hand there are naturally grown woods and on the other hand composites such as MDF, chipboard, multiplex – each of them with different characteristics and requirements. Wood objects to be processed can be small or large, in parts or assembled, curved or flat, vertical or horizontal, with complex or simple shapes. WAGNER offers a wide range of technologies for manual and automatic coating applications and feeding of the material, as well as tools and units for mixing and dosing.

Powder Coating

WAGNER‘s MDF powder coating technology provides a wrap-around, seamless finish, achieving an even colour on every surface. It‘s eco-friendly and enables immediate further processing of the coated object.
